FAQ
What is HBase?
HBase is an open-source, distributed, non-relational database modeled after Google's Bigtable and is designed to provide real-time read/write access to large datasets.
Is HBase suitable for handling big data?
Yes, HBase is designed to handle massive amounts of data distributed across a cluster of machines efficiently.
What are some key features of HBase?
Some key features of HBase include automatic sharding, scalability, fault-tolerance, and consistent read and write performance.
What kind of data model does HBase use?
HBase uses a column-oriented data model where data is stored in tables consisting of rows and columns.
Can HBase be integrated with other big data technologies like Hadoop?
Yes, HBase can be easily integrated with other big data technologies like Apache Hadoop for seamless data processing and analysis.
How does HBase ensure fault-tolerance?
HBase ensures fault-tolerance through mechanisms like replication, region servers, and distributed storage.
Is HBase suitable for real-time applications?
Yes, HBase is suitable for real-time applications that require low-latency read and write access to large datasets.
Is HBase schemaless?
While HBase does not enforce a strict schema upfront, applications often define schemas to effectively manage and query data.
What programming languages are commonly used to interact with HBase?
Java is the most commonly used language for interacting with HBase. There are also client libraries available for languages like Python and Scala.
Is it possible to perform ACID transactions in HBase?
HBase does not natively support ACID transactions on single rows but can simulate transactional behavior using features like Compare-and-Swap (CAS).
